i have a small netwofk with 8 computers all running win xp pro, (WORK GORUP)
i want local users on each computer to see nothing but ONLY internet
explorer on the screen, and when they hit the start button they should only
see DOCUMENTS.

But i want ADMINISTRATOR to able to see everything as usual, how do i do
that ?

Am thankful for any that i may get.
 
Your best bet is to look at the free Shared Computer Toolkit that requires
SP2. You can really lockdown restricted accounts with it though I don't know
if you can get it quite to the point that you want. You can also use local
Group Policy via gpedit.msc to restrict users though by default restrictions
will apply to all users on the computer but a common hack is to give
administrators deny read permissions to the
\Windows\system32\grouppolicy\users folder. You will see a plethora of
options to restrict users under user configuration /administrative
templates. If you do not want those computers ever to be able to access
shares on the network then disable Client for Microsoft Networks on
hem. --- Steve
